InfoI have successfully spearheaded numerous civic projects and I'm experienced with committee processes, efficient budgeting, economic development strategies, environmental issues, multi-million dollar public works projects, & real world business practices. I have a proven track record of working with people from diverse viewpoints & backgrounds without prejudice.



I have endless energy, I'm a quick learner, and I've donated thousands of hours of civic service to my communities. When I make a commitment, I keep it. And I'm not motivated by power, control, money, or party politics. So I'll be able to get to the root of the issues and make logical decisions based on facts.




CAREER: Plenty of blue collar and white collar experience...

•20 years - Reputable Business Owner: Consulting, Design, Construction Mgt, General Contractor - specializing in community enhancement, landscape development, rural revitalization projects. I never left a bill unpaid, a job undone, or had a claim filed against my business.(1992-present)

•7 years - Parks & Public Works Administration: Roads, parks, natural resources, recreation, & public involvement programs. When I worked in public service, I knew who I worked for & why. So listening to, interacting with, and serving the public faithfully was my top priority. (1988-94)




COLLEGE EDUCATION: 5 years, 3 degrees, with honors…

•Associate in Applied Science – President’s Medal top graduate, Wenatchee Valley College, Wenatchee, WA 1986-87

•Associate in Arts & Sciences – 4.0 GPA/straight A’s, Wenatchee Valley College, Wenatchee, WA 1987-88

•Bachelor of Science -- Magna Cum Laude academic honors, Western State College of Colorado, Gunnison, CO 1989-90




VOLUNTEER SERVICE: I've always had a heart community…

•9 years, Project Leader - Thompson Falls Beautification

•3 years, Chair - Fort Thompson Playground

•Current President - Sanders County Historical Society

•5 years, Chair - David Thompson Days Community Celebration

•Current Board of Directors - Sanders Natural Resource Council

•2 year Vice President - Thompson Falls Community Development Association

•Current Member - U.S. David Thompson Bicentennial Partnership, Educator Workshop Planning Committee

•Current Member - Clark Fork Valley Elks Lodge




FAMILY, FAITH, & INTERESTS: A blessed life in the land we love…

My husband Paul and I enjoy living a simple, but active, life close to the land. He's a retired wildlife biologist and avid outdoorsman. We have two grown children & five beautiful grandkids – we are all Christians. Most of our free time is dedicated to Hunting, Fishing, Trapping, Gardening, Firewooding, Historical Education, Hiking, Canoeing, and managing our forest land for optimal timber quality & wildlife habitat.
